- [ ] Step 7: Archive cold storage buckets (Glacierline tier). Confirm both ceremony witnesses are present, verify bucket manifests match the Oxbow ledger, then seal the archive key shares. Plugin authors may observe but not handle shares. Once sealed, the archive index itself is encrypted and can only be reopened with the passphrase below.

vault phrase of badup-hahig = tamael-aldael-kelmir-istael-fenok-istwyn-tamius-jorath-oliion

Context for your review: the Orrery API's `teamMembers` resolver previously issued one query per member to fetch role assignments, producing classic N+1 behavior — roughly 400 queries on large orgs. This change introduces a batched dataloader keyed on member ID, with a per-request cache. Please verify the loader is scoped per request, not globally, and that the batch function preserves input ordering. Benchmarks and the full loader conventions doc are on the internal page linked below.

wiki page, tahaf-tajog: https://jira.ordindyn.corp/pipeline

## Runbook: Log Sampling for Murmur Relay

If you build plugins for Murmur Relay, know this: the service is loud. We sample debug and info lines at 1:100 in production, so don't assume every log call lands in the aggregator. Errors and warnings always ship. If your plugin needs guaranteed trace lines, tag them with the `keep` marker instead of cranking verbosity — that just gets you sampled harder. Sampling tiers, marker syntax, and override rules are documented on the internal page.

dashboard of bafof-hafog = https://confluence.lumiclabs.internal/display/browse/display/6a09a20a